The tweets with the highest number of interactions below Aevo’s new tweets are fake phishing tweets, please be aware of them.
Aevo officially posted a picture with the caption "March 13th" on social media, which may be a preview of AEVO's TGE time. It is worth noting that this tweet is not a thread and there is no "end of tweet" warning. Currently, the top reply to the tweet has been occupied by a high imitation account that has inflated the number of likes and has posted information about airdrops and phishing links. Users should be aware and discerning.
